Dual shear wave induced laser speckle contrast signal and the improvement in shear wave speed measurement

Shear wave speed is quantitatively related to tissue viscoelasticity. Previously we reported shear wave tracking at centimetre depths in a turbid optical medium using laser speckle contrast detection. Shear wave progression modulates displacement of optical scatterers and therefore modulates photon phase and changes the laser speckle patterns. Time-resolved charge-coupled device (CCD)-based speckle contrast analysis was used to track shear waves and measure the time-of-flight of shear waves for speed measurement. In this manuscript, we report a new observation of the laser speckle contrast difference signal for dual shear waves. A modulation of CCD speckle contrast difference was observed and simulation reproduces the modulation pattern, suggesting its origin. Both experimental and simulation results show that the dual shear wave approach generates an improved definition of temporal features in the time-of-flight optical signal and an improved signal to noise ratio with a standard deviation less than 50% that of individual shear waves. Results also show that dual shear waves can correct the bias of shear wave speed measurement caused by shear wave reflections from elastic boundaries.
